Music Theater Heritage celebrates and elevates the shared legacy of American music and theater. We exist to preserve their cultural significance, explore their evolving forms and inspire future generations through bold and innovative storytelling. Rooted in heritage and driven by imagination, we champion the power of live experiences for reflection, connection, and transformation.

What Arts, Culture & Humanities executives earn in Missouri
Comparable arts, culture & humanities organizations in Missouri pay their highest-earning executive a median of $59,173.
These are arts, culture & humanities s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 77 organizations across 77 filings (2022 – 2023).
